RTP, or Return to Player, is a crucial concept in the world of crypto casinos. It represents the percentage of wagered money that a game is expected to return to players over time. For instance, if a slot machine has an RTP of 95%, it means that, on average, players can expect to receive $95 back for every $100 wagered. Understanding RTP is essential for players, as it directly impacts potential winnings and helps make informed decisions when choosing which games to play.
In crypto casinos, the RTP can vary significantly from one game to another. Factors influencing RTP include game design, volatility, and the specific rules of the game. Players should always check the RTP percentages of various games before diving in. High RTP games typically offer better long-term returns, making them a preferred choice for savvy gamblers. By prioritizing games with higher RTPs, players can maximize their chances of walking away with substantial winnings.

The concept of RTP, or Return to Player, is a critical element in the world of online gambling, as it directly influences the potential profitability for players. Several factors contribute to determining the RTP of a casino game, making it essential for players to understand how these variables work. First and foremost, the game type plays a significant role; for instance, slot games typically have a different RTP compared to table games like blackjack or roulette. Additionally, the volatility of a game affects the RTP, as high volatility games may offer bigger wins but at less frequent intervals, while low volatility games provide smaller, more consistent payouts.
Another crucial factor influencing RTP is the developer's settings. Game developers have the ability to adjust RTP percentages based on their business models and target markets. This means that the same game can have varying RTP values across different online casinos. Furthermore, regulatory environments also play a part; licensed online casinos often must adhere to jurisdiction-specific guidelines that dictate minimum RTP percentages.
